Problems solved by technology

Because the quality of film winding is mainly affected by the tension of film winding, if the tension is too high, the winding is too tight, and the film is prone to wrinkles; It is easy to produce axial slippage and serious misalignment on the die, so that it cannot be unloaded
As the diameter of the parent roll increases, if the speed of the winding roller remains unchanged, the tension of the winding will inevitably increase as the winding line speed increases (because the speed of the film sent from the traction device is constant) , this will not only cause the inner looseness and outer tightness of the roll film, the outer film will wrinkle the inner film, but also increase the difficulty of rewinding during slitting and affect the quality of slitting. Therefore, in order to avoid the above effects, each specification of tube The length of the film carried by the core has a limit value, especially in the field of lithium battery separators, generally a roll is about 1000 meters
However, with the widespread industrial application of lithium battery separators, the market urgently needs to increase the winding length of the film to facilitate industrial operations. In order to achieve this goal, an elastic surface layer is currently added to the surface of the winding roller to buffer the internal stress. However, this method of adding a buffer layer on the surface of the die can only increase the film winding length from 1,000 meters to about 1,500 meters under the same conditions. The improvement is limited and still cannot meet the requirements of industrial applications. , so the market urgently needs a technology that can significantly increase the length of film winding

Abstract

The invention discloses a method for increasing the winding length of a film. The method is to feed in a material as a separation layer during the film winding process so that the material is wound between the film layers. In the present invention, by setting a separation layer between the film layers, on the one hand, the stress release of the films inside and outside the separation layer can be offset to obtain a film roll with a smooth surface; The outer diameter of the winding tube core is reduced, so that the limit length of the film that can be rolled is increased. Therefore, through the number of layers of the separation layer, any required film length can be rolled, which can meet various needs of industrial applications.
